### Consent Banner Service Authentication

All calls to the Bannerly rollout API must include a service credential; unauthenticated requests are rejected at the Verdane gateway before reaching the consent-state store. Maintainers should rotate this credential each quarter and confirm the banner variant cache invalidates cleanly afterward. For the current deployment cycle, requests should be signed with the key below.

service key, bajep-hahig: zpat15_8GdlyV2kd9BCqYH

## Deployment: Timezone Handling

Report exports from Quillbeam render timestamps in the tenant's configured zone, not UTC. The converter runs at export time; stored data stays UTC. Mismatched zones cause off-by-one-day totals in daily rollups, so verify the tenant map before each release. Restart the export worker after any change. The current production settings are as follows.

deployment values, bafog-tajop:
NOVAEL_PIN=7103
NOVAEL_TENANT=weneth
NOVAEL_METRICS_HOST=metrics.novael.crelvocorp.corp
NOVAEL_SEAL=seal_be72a3d3
NOVAEL_STANDBY_TEAM=caseth

Hey, welcome aboard! Quick note on this change to the RateVault lookup cache: we memoize tax rates per jurisdiction, but stale entries caused that Pellford invoicing bug last quarter, so the TTLs are deliberately conservative. Don't bump them without running the reconciliation suite first — it's cheap and saves headaches. For reference, the knobs you'll most likely touch are these.

constants for tageg-kagag:
QUOTAS = {
    "kelax": 495,
    "istath": 366,
    "tammir": 108,
    "novdor": 730,
    "casax": 816,
    "quenael": 874,
    "pelius": 403,
}

GiveNote sends donation receipts for the Lanternwell platform. Each mailer worker opens a session with the receipt API at startup, renews it every 20 minutes, and closes it on shutdown. Sessions are per-worker; never share one across workers, since the API rate-limits by session and you'll starve your neighbors.

If a session expires mid-batch, the worker retries once, then dead-letters the receipt. Logs show session IDs truncated to eight characters.

To open a sandbox session manually, authenticate with the token below.

login token, bagug-kafop: eyJhbGciOiJIUzI1NiIsInR5cCI6IkpXVCJ9.eyJzdWIiOiIcMLov2In0.Z5RLDIfp